I had one of these installed in my 04 Sentra a few weeks ago from a local company called chronic Car Audio. I have no say in the installation process, but all in all its not too bad. It is SUPER sensitive and tends to go off at the slightest bump. A large truck driving by it will set it off sometimes. Normally it would drive me nuts, but I like that knowing the 2500 dollar sound system I have inside is a bit more safe.
